About This Item
IEEE 2888.3-2024 defines requirements for orchestration of digital synchronization between cyber and physical worlds, making it relevant to computing and processing systems that must coordinate time-sensitive actions across connected environments. IEEE 2888.3-2024 is useful where synchronization affects interoperability, control accuracy, or system timing, especially in engineered settings that link software-driven logic with physical processes. Its focus helps support consistent implementation, testing, and integration of synchronization workflows.
About IEEE 2888.3-2024
This standard addresses the orchestration layer needed to manage digital synchronization between cyber and physical worlds. In practical terms, it may guide how computing systems coordinate signals, events, or data exchanges so that physical operations align with digital control logic. IEEE 2888.3-2024 is therefore a technical reference for organizations that need a clearer basis for design, validation, and interoperability when synchronization is part of the system architecture.
